As the Director of UK Government Relations, you will work within the Corporate Legal team, where you will be responsible for the development and implementation of an integrated UK government relations strategy.
Key Responsibilities
·       Build, develop, manage, and coordinate relationships with key UK GR stakeholders, including high-profile trade associations, across the full portfolio of Pearson’s interests to build relationships to identify and pursue opportunities and mitigate risk across the five verticals.
·       Represent Pearson at speaking events, in meetings with government officials and stakeholders and in association and partnership activities
·       Create and lead execution of external engagement plan featuring consultants and business leaders, managing external GR agency to maximize support and impact.
·       Join up with UK Comms to ensure consistency of internal and external messaging and to cocreate campaigns to promote positioning and business goals.
·       Develop key metrics and analysing insights to inform on international communications and government relations strategies and tactics.
·       Track, monitor, advocate and report on relevant legislation and regulatory proceedings and assist in the drafting and delivery of oral and written testimony and ensure compliance with lobbying and reporting rules and regulations.
·       Provide tactical support and strategic counsel on all government relations issues to senior leaders.
